which discharger?
 
Spintec Battery Manager or INTEGY Indi 030?

TexRacer 09-26-2005 06:28 AM

They are actually 2 different TYPES of discharges so your question is hard to answer.
1 is a device that discharges slowly with a pulse built in.
2 is a tray that discharges each cell at a HIGH RATE.

The Spintec or the Trinity Dyna Pulse is a great idea but it's best if you STILL get a tray.

Since I race 4 and 6 cell I went with the trinity dyna and then have a rayspeed tray.

You cant really loose with either of the choices you have asked about but eventually with the Spintec you would want a tray as well to back it up.
I would NOT spend the money on a Integy 30 if I bought a Spintec.I would buy a tray that discharges at alot lower amp rate.
Tekin Tray,Novak Tray,Integy zero tray,trinity tray,and/or others.
I use the Rayspeed tray due to quality,fan and being able to switch the cutoff.

hmm.... this is what i did...
i bought the 030.... great discharger for ppl runs stock and 19t..
and it only takes 6~7 min to discharge the whole pack full of charge

then i got the dyna pulse, great to bring some of my old practice pack back
to some life... down side is... it takes almost 7hours to discharge the
full pack. so i only cycle the practice pack with it..

last i got the integy 06s, i try my race pack down to 0v and leave it till next race.

if you are running mod... I think you just need some tray that will
tray your pack down to .9v with low amp discharge.. ie. novak smart tray.
